I have also done head to toe measurements, weight and taken her body fat measurement using a Bioimpedance Analyzer.
Rita has goals of overall health improvement. I, personally, have other goals for her.
Her current Bodyfat percentage is way to high at 44%. My goal is to get this down to under 25% - a healthy percentage taking away her increased risk of all sorts of heart diseases and other health issues. (Did that make sense? I just felt myself rambling)
Now, with regards to her measurements, I took a total of 12 measurements. When all these numbers are added up Rita's total inches are 384.75. This is the number that I want to see the most significant changes to. I'll keep you up to date.
So. Rita's goals for this week are as follows.
1. To eat something every 2-3 hours, never going over three hours
2. To consume 250 mls of water at each of those meals
3. To continue journalling
4. To try and spend between 10-20 minutes/day that she would ordinarily be sitting and do something moving during that time.
